RSB POLICY LATES: WHY PROTECT OCEAN BIODIVERSITY?

The Royal Society of Biology is running a Policy Lates panel discussion looking at the benefits humans derive from marine organisms and ecosystems, and why biodiversity is important for many aspects of life outside of the ocean.
Chaired by Professor Melanie Austen FRSB, University of Plymouth, the panel will discuss the value of marine biodiversity to people, including the interactions between the marine environment and the global climate, and the challenges of developing international conservation targets for the world's oceans.
